    New Value-Added Services for Classics E-Journals

    No full text
    This paper examines issues related to electronic journal publishing in the field of Classics with a specific focus on the discussion of new value-added services for e-journals. Preliminary experimental data from a survey that explored the diffusion of digital technologies into the publishing workflow of Italian Classics journals identified two new value-added services: reference linking to primary sources and semantic indexing. This paper also emphasizes the importance of supporting citation persistence for electronic resources. Finally, it will describe the significance and overall functioning of these services and then conclude with an outline of the characteristics of the main technical components needed for an e-journal implementation that provides these identified services through an extension of the Open Journal Systems (OJS) platform

    Review of the volume of Anna Bellodi Ansaloni, L’arte dell’avvocato, 'actor veritatis'. Studi di retorica e di deontologia forense (Bologna, Bononia University Press, 2016) p. 275 + 3 n.n. The volume describes the importance of rhetoric with precious comparisons between the Roman world and the modern one. Rhetoric, essentially, is among the fundamental disciplines of the legal practitioner. Its correct use, both in oral form and in written form, has contributed in a capital way to the formation of the stereotype of the jurist. The book also analyzes the ethics, it is strongly linked to moral and to the correct use of rhetoric as an instrument of truth and not only for vanity

    Histochemical and immunohistochemical profile of pink muscle fibres in some teleosts.

    No full text
    The pink muscle of several Teleosts was examined immunohistochemically using antisera specific for the myosins of red and white muscle, and histochemically using various methods for demonstrating myosin ATPase (mATPase) activity. In the catfish the pink muscle consists of 2 different layers of fibres. The superficial layer has a low mATPase activity after both acid and alkali pre-incubation, whereas the deeper layer has a high mATPase activity after acid and alkali pre-incubation, being more resistent to these conditions even than is the white muscle. In the trout the pink muscle is composed of fibres with the same mATPase activity as in the superficial pink muscle of the catfish, whereas in the rock goby, goldfish, mullet and guppy the pink muscle is like the deep pink layer of the catfish. Immunohistochemically the fibres of the pink muscle behave like the white muscle fibres except in the guppy and rock goby in which at the level of the lateral line there occurs a transition zone between red and pink fibres. The fibres of this region react with both anti-fast and (to a lesser extent) anti-slow myosin antisera, and have a mATPase activity which, going from the superficial to the deeper fibres, gradually loses the red muscle characteristics to acquire those of the main pink muscle layer
